Michael Porter Jr. – Over 34.5 Points + Rebounds + Assists (-119)

In player props, there is no such thing as a lock. However, recent trends would suggest that this is as close to that as we can get. In his last three games, Porter Jr. has beaten this mark with his points alone. The other game, he came up just 1.5 points away from doing it. That means what he gets in rebounds and assists – which is generally around 10 per game – is almost just a bonus. Sure, he isn’t going to keep up a 34.3 points per game average, but Dallas doesn’t exactly have a tough defense either.

Matas Buzelis – Over 14.5 Points (-109)

As the Bulls have slowly fallen apart and begun to lose hope on their season, they have realized the need to grow their young players. As a result, Buzelis has been more of a focal point in the offense. In his last four games, we’ve seen an huge increase in his shot attempts and he’s cleared this projection in three of the four. Charlotte is one of the very worst defenses in the league, and his line is only this low because he had eight points last time they played. However, he had a rough night from three-point that day, and it was before the aformentioned increase.

Nickeil Alexander-Walker – Over 3.5 Three-Pointers (+149)

This may seem like a big ask for our final prop, but Alexander-Walker has been handling it with ease. In his last six games, he’s been over this mark in four of them. His average in that span is 4.5 makes per game. Up against Detroit, the Hawks are likely going to be chasing points early and often. That just means more attempts for Alexander-Walker in this one.
